I have recently started having the same problem and feel people are misinterpreting the OP’s complaint.

After using Deezer for years without issue, i now see a Queue full of music i have never added, do not care for, from top 40 artists i actively avoid and do not follow, every time i open Deezer on my Windows PC. 

 

Its 98 tracks of top 40 stuff I have never listened to like Ariana Grande and Lily Allen. (for context i mostly listen to experimental electronica, never pop).

 

If i clear the queue one by one, clicking the X symbol next to each track, then the queue is clear apart from one track, but when i close and re-open Deezer…  this cursed queue returns! So the issue is not with CLEARING the queue (which is indeed onerous), but with the Queue being seemingly auto-populated from somewhere whenever i open the app.

 

I suspect this is another dreadful development in the Deezer service - a feature rather than a bug - much like the Notifications suddenly becoming populated with random garbage from artists we don’t follow, in an effort to promote said artists at the expense of the UX.

 

At one point i started to wonder if someone else was using my Deezer account, unauthorised, and considered changing my password. In my view if a feature feels like account compromise, it is a bad feature!

 

As a workaround i am using Synchronised Queue list which takes a queue from my Android phone (of music i was actually listening to) and presents it on my PC, but really this feature seems broken to me in it’s current state.
